What Makes a Moist Black Forest Cake Recipe at Home Special?

Black Forest Cake is a timeless dessert made with moist chocolate sponge layers, whipped cream frosting, cherries, and chocolate shavings. Originating from Germany, this cake is loved worldwide for its rich chocolate flavor and light, creamy texture.

If you’ve ever wondered why bakery Black Forest cakes are so soft and moist, these seven secrets will help you achieve the same results at home.

Secret #1: Use Quality Ingredients for a Moist Black Forest Cake Recipe at Home

Using high-quality ingredients is one of the most important factors in baking. According to Bigger Bolder Baking Articles – Tips & Techniques to Bake with Confidence!, ingredient quality and accurate measurements significantly affect cake texture and consistency.

Choose:

  • Premium cocoa powder
  • Fresh eggs
  • Good-quality vanilla extract
  • Fresh whipping cream
  • High-quality chocolate for shavings

Using fresh ingredients ensures better moisture retention and richer flavor.


Secret #2: Measure Ingredients Accurately

Baking is a science.

Too much flour can make the cake dense, while excess liquid can cause sinking.

Professional bakers recommend weighing ingredients instead of using cups for better accuracy. The experts at Sally’s Baking Addiction Baking Tips explain how precise measurements improve baking results.

For best results:

  • Use a digital kitchen scale.
  • Sift dry ingredients before mixing.
  • Follow measurements precisely.

Accurate measurements create a soft and even cake crumb.


Secret #3: Don’t Overmix the Batter

One of the biggest mistakes beginners make is overmixing.

Overmixing develops gluten, resulting in a tough cake.

Mix only until:

  • Dry ingredients disappear.
  • Batter looks smooth.
  • No flour pockets remain.

A gentle mixing technique keeps the cake fluffy and moist.


Secret #4: Use Coffee for Rich Chocolate Flavor

A small amount of hot coffee enhances chocolate flavor without making the cake taste like coffee.

Benefits:

  • Intensifies cocoa flavor.
  • Adds depth and richness.
  • Creates a darker chocolate sponge.

This is a professional baker’s secret for a more luxurious Black Forest Cake.


Secret #5: Soak Cake Layers Properly

The signature moisture of Black Forest Cake comes from soaking the sponge layers.

Simple Sugar Syrup Recipe:

  • 100 ml water
  • 50 g sugar

Boil and cool completely.

Brush generously over each cake layer before frosting.

This prevents dryness and keeps the cake moist for longer.


Secret #6: Whip Fresh Cream Correctly

Perfect whipped cream should be:

  • Light
  • Stable
  • Smooth

Tips:

  • Chill the bowl and whisk.
  • Use cold whipping cream.
  • Whip until medium peaks form.

Overwhipping can make the cream grainy and difficult to spread.


Secret #7: Decorate Like a Professional

Traditional Black Forest Cake decoration includes:

  • Fresh whipped cream
  • Chocolate curls
  • Cherries
  • Piped cream rosettes

For bakery-style presentation:

  • Apply a crumb coat first.
  • Chill before final frosting.
  • Use a cake scraper for smooth sides.

A beautiful finish makes your cake look professional and inviting.

Ingredients

For the Chocolate Sponge

  • 200 g all-purpose flour
  • 50 g cocoa powder
  • 200 g sugar
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• ½ tsp baking soda
  • 3 large eggs
  • 120 ml vegetable oil
  • 150 ml milk
  • 100 ml hot coffee

For the Sugar Syrup

  • 100 ml water
  • 50 g sugar

For the Whipped Cream Frosting

  • 500 ml chilled whipping cream
  • 50 g icing sugar

For Decoration

  • Fresh or canned cherries
  • Chocolate shavings
  • Chocolate curls (optional)

Understanding the Ingredients

Before making your moist black forest cake, it’s helpful to understand how each ingredient contributes to the final result.

Flour

All-purpose flour provides structure to the cake while keeping it soft and tender.

Cocoa Powder

Good-quality cocoa powder gives the cake its deep chocolate flavor and rich color.

Eggs

Eggs help bind the ingredients together while adding volume and softness to the sponge.

Oil

Unlike butter, oil keeps the cake moist for a longer period, making it an important ingredient in a moist black forest cake.

Coffee

Coffee intensifies the chocolate flavor without making the cake taste like coffee.

Sugar Syrup

This is one of the most important elements in creating an extra moist black forest cake. The syrup keeps the sponge soft and prevents dryness.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Prepare the Oven and Cake Pans

Preheat your oven to 170°C (340°F).

Grease two 8-inch round cake pans with oil or butter and line the bottoms with parchment paper. This prevents sticking and ensures clean cake layers.

Proper preparation at this stage helps maintain the shape and texture of your moist black forest cake.

Step 2: Sift the Dry Ingredients

In a large bowl, sift together:

  • Flour
  • Cocoa powder
  • Baking powder
  • Baking soda

Sifting helps aerate the mixture and removes lumps, creating a lighter cake texture.

Mix everything well and set aside.

Step 3: Beat the Eggs and Sugar

In another mixing bowl, combine the eggs and sugar.

Using an electric mixer, beat for about 4–5 minutes until the mixture becomes pale, thick, and creamy.

This step creates air bubbles that contribute to a soft and fluffy sponge.

Step 4: Add Oil, Milk, and Coffee

Gradually pour in the oil while continuing to mix.

Add the milk and hot coffee and mix until fully incorporated.

The batter will become smooth and slightly thin, which is perfectly normal for a moist black forest cake batter.

Step 5: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ients

Add the dry ingredients in three batches.

Using a spatula, gently fold the mixture after each addition.

Avoid vigorous stirring because overmixing can develop gluten and make the cake dense.

The final batter should be smooth and lump-free.

Step 6: Bake the Cake

Divide the batter evenly between the prepared cake pans.

Tap the pans lightly on the counter to release trapped air bubbles.

Bake for 30–35 minutes.

To check for doneness:

  • Insert a toothpick into the center.
  • It should come out with a few moist crumbs attached.

Do not overbake. Overbaking is one of the main reasons cakes lose moisture.

Step 7: Cool Completely

Allow the cakes to cool in their pans for 10 minutes.

Carefully remove them from the pans and place them on a wire rack.

Let them cool completely before frosting.

Applying whipped cream to warm cake layers can cause the frosting to melt.

Step 8: Prepare the Sugar Syrup

Combine water and sugar in a saucepan.

Heat gently until the sugar dissolves completely.

Allow the syrup to cool.

Using a pastry brush, generously soak each cake layer with the syrup.

This step transforms an ordinary chocolate cake into an incredibly moist black forest cake.

Step 9: Prepare the Whipped Cream

Place the chilled whipping cream and icing sugar in a cold mixing bowl.

Whip until medium to stiff peaks form.

The cream should hold its shape but still look smooth and silky.

Avoid overwhipping, as it can become grainy.

Step 10: Assemble the Moist Black Forest Cake

Place the first cake layer on a cake board or serving plate.

Brush generously with sugar syrup.

Spread an even layer of whipped cream.

Add chopped cherries over the cream layer.

The cherries add sweetness, texture, and the signature flavor associated with a traditional moist black forest cake.

Place the second cake layer on top.

Brush with more sugar syrup.

Step 11: Apply a Crumb Coat

Spread a thin layer of whipped cream over the entire cake.

This locks in loose crumbs and creates a smooth foundation.

Refrigerate for 15–20 minutes.

Step 12: Final Frosting

Apply a thicker layer of whipped cream over the chilled cake.

Use an offset spatula or cake scraper to create a smooth finish on the top and sides.

Take your time during this step for a professional-looking result.

Step 13: Decorate Like a Bakery Cake

Cover the sides with chocolate shavings.

Pipe whipped cream rosettes around the top edge.

Place cherries on each rosette.

Sprinkle additional chocolate curls across the top for an elegant finish.

Your beautiful moist black forest cake is now ready for chilling.

Step 14: Chill Before Serving

Refrigerate the cake for at least 4 hours.

Overnight chilling is even better because it allows the flavors to develop and the sponge to absorb additional moisture.

Expert Tips for an Extra Moist Black Forest Cake

  • Use room-temperature eggs for better volume.
  • Always sift cocoa powder and flour.
  • Do not skip the sugar syrup.
  • Chill the whipping cream before whipping.
  • Use good-quality cocoa powder.
  • Avoid overbaking the sponge.
  • Refrigerate the cake before slicing.
  • Use freshly grated chocolate for decoration.

How to Store Moist Black Forest Cake

Store the cake in an airtight cake container in the refrigerator.

It stays fresh for up to 3 days.

For the best flavor and texture, allow the cake to sit at room temperature for 15 minutes before serving.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why is my Moist Black Forest Cake dry?

Dryness usually occurs due to overbaking or insufficient sugar syrup. Proper soaking is essential for a truly moist black forest cake.

Can I make Moist Black Forest Cake without coffee?

Yes. Replace the coffee with hot water or warm milk. Coffee simply enhances the chocolate flavor.

Can I use canned cherries?

Absolutely. Canned cherries work very well and are commonly used in Black Forest Cake recipes.

How far in advance can I make the cake?

You can prepare the moist black forest cake one day in advance. In fact, chilling overnight often improves the flavor and texture.
